  • Patent number: 9934465
    Abstract: Techniques for analyzing and synthesizing complex knowledge representations (KRs) may utilize an atomic knowledge representation model including both an elemental data structure and knowledge processing rules stored as machine-readable data and/or programming instructions. One or more of the knowledge processing rules may be applied to analyze an input complex KR to deconstruct its complex concepts and/or concept relationships to elemental concepts and/or concept relationships to be included in the elemental data structure. One or more of the knowledge processing rules may be applied to synthesize an output complex KR from the stored elemental data structure in accordance with an input context. Multiple input complex KRs of various types may be analyzed and deconstructed to populate the elemental data structure, and input complex KRs may be transformed through the elemental data structure to output complex KRs of different types, providing semantic interoperability to KRs of different types and/or KR models.

  • Publication number: 20170371782
    Abstract: In some examples, techniques for virtual storage includes configuring a single physical storage disk to a virtual storage device that includes a plurality of virtual storage disks from a command specifying storage characteristics of the virtual storage disks including number of virtual storage disks, virtual strip size, and fault tolerance of the virtual storage disks. In response to access the virtual storage disks and specifying a virtual storage disk Logical Block Address (LBA), converting the virtual storage disk LBA into a physical storage disk LBA based on a sum of factors that includes a first factor comprising a modulo of the virtual storage disk LBA and virtual strip size, a second factor comprising number of virtual storage disks multiplied by a result of the virtual storage disk LBA minus the first factor, and a third factor comprising a virtual storage disk number multiplied by the virtual strip size.

  • Patent number: 9645049
    Abstract: A soot generating device suitable for calibration purposes and a method of using the device for calibrating a soot measuring apparatus are presented. The soot generating device includes a wick located relative to a burning zone, a gas diffusion shield surrounding the burning zone that allows a continuous stream of air into the combustion zone, and a fuel supply for delivering fuel to the wick.
